#0bb76b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0bb76b is composed of 4.3% red, 71.8%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.5%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 153.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 38%. #0bb76b color hex could be obtained by blending #16ffd6 with #006f00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#0bb76b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01100a is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0bb76b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6561 is the less saturated color, while #04be6c is the most saturated one.
